Changlu in context

With 968 people at the 2011 Census, Changlu was the 74th most populous of its district's 131 villages, below the district average of 1,647.

Literacy stood at 35.94%, 16.6 points below the district's rural average of 52.54%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 786, 137 below the rural national 923.

73.2% of the population were recorded as workers, 10.8 points above the district's rural rate.
